WebThe most St. Louis families were found in USA in 1880. In 1880 there were 32 St. Louis families living in Wisconsin. This was about 21% of all the recorded St. Louis's in USA. Wisconsin had the highest population of St. Louis families in 1880. Use census records and voter lists to see where families with the St. Louis surname lived. WebOn both sides of the center circle, a bear, represents strength and bravery; a crescent moon, a symbol of the Virgin Mary and a nod to the French who first settled Missouri, represents the newness of statehood and the potential for growth. Surrounding these symbols is the motto "United we stand, divided we fall". Derived from an Indian word meaning "across the water" and appearing in the 1855 Third City Subdivision of the St. Louis Commons. (Compton Hill) ACME AVENUE (N-S). Draws its name from the word "acme", the highest point of attainment. Originated in the 1907 Acme Heights subdivision.
